<pre data-block="statement">What this chapter covers | Mañjula is one link in a long chain. We read Āryabhaṭa's encoded sine-table (the foundation), Bhāskara II's verses on instantaneous velocity a step beyond Mañjula, and see the lineage reach its height in Mādhava's Kerala school — whose own Sphuṭacandrāpti computed the true Moon at short intervals, and whose infinite series for sine, cosine and π are a true calculus, centuries before Europe.</pre>
